WebWe can measure punching force (the action of one body on another) in the lab. The metric we use is called a Newton (after Sir Isaac Newton). The higher the Newton (N) the greater the force or harder the punch. Punching forces in amateur boxing are around 2500 N. WebHowever, they are not. When we are using a scale, we actually want to learn about the mass we have, and this is what the scale shows us when it reflects the result in kilograms or pounds. However, the scale is not measuring our mass. It just measures the force, which is our weight. It simply converts the readings from the force we exert into ...
